Subject: Key rotation for sqlsentry lint service

For the weekly sync: we've rotated the credential that the sqlsentry bot uses to fetch lint rule bundles for SQL files. This accompanies the new ruleset (bans implicit casts in migrations, enforces lowercase keywords). CI runners pick up the change automatically; local pre-commit users must update their config by Friday or lint fetches will 401. Pipelines pinned to the old key keep working through Thursday. The replacement key for the lint rule service appears below.

app token of kagap-fahag = zpat2_0m

### Static-Analysis Baseline

New hires at Bramblewood should know that `lintbase.yml` pins every pre-existing warning in the Corvid codebase. Never add entries manually; regenerate it with `corvid lint --rebaseline` and include the diff in your PR. Unexplained baseline growth will block merges. If the rebaseline tool misbehaves or flags files you didn't touch, contact the tooling team at the address below.

escalation mailbox, hadug-bajog: sormir@norvalabs.internal

Runbook 7.2 — Image Slimming Rollout (Tidewren service). Before promoting the slimmed container image, confirm the health probe passes on two canary nodes and that shell access is not required, since the distroless base omits it. Roll back immediately if probe latency exceeds baseline by 20%. The canary deployment runs with the following configuration values:

deployment values, kajep-kageg:
[praix]
host = praix.paliqcorp.corp
user = praix_svc
database = praix_prod